This Certificate Programme in Forest Nursery Production Optimization equips participants with the practical skills and theoretical knowledge necessary for efficient and sustainable forest nursery management. The program focuses on optimizing seed germination, seedling growth, and overall nursery productivity, leading to healthier and more robust seedlings for reforestation and afforestation projects.
Upon completion of this intensive program, participants will be able to design and implement improved nursery practices, manage pest and disease outbreaks effectively, and employ data-driven decision-making for resource allocation. Key learning outcomes include mastering propagation techniques, understanding plant physiology, and implementing sustainable nursery operations, contributing directly to improved forestry practices and environmental conservation.
The program's duration is typically six months, incorporating a blend of classroom instruction, hands-on field training, and practical exercises in a real-world nursery setting.
